Starting Your Journey: The Planning Phase

A successful remodel hinges on thorough planning. Skimping here can lead to budget overruns, delays, and dissatisfaction.

  1. Define Your Vision & Goals: What do you want to achieve? Gather inspiration from magazines, Pinterest, Houzz, and design shows. Create mood boards that capture the look, feel, and functionality you envision. Be specific about colors, materials, and styles.
  2. Set a Realistic Budget (and Stick to It!): This is perhaps the most crucial step. Research average costs for the type of remodel you’re considering. Factor in not just materials and labor, but also permits, potential unforeseen issues (always budget an extra 10-20% for contingencies!), and temporary living arrangements if needed.
  3. Prioritize Needs vs. Wants: Distinguish between what’s essential for functionality and what’s a desirable upgrade. This helps you make smart decisions if budget adjustments become necessary.
  4. Consider Your Lifestyle: How do you really use the space? Do you cook elaborate meals or prefer quick bites? Do you need a serene retreat or a bustling family hub? Design should always follow function.
  5. Research & Educate Yourself: Understand different material options, their durability, maintenance, and cost. Knowing the pros and cons of various flooring types, countertop materials, or cabinet finishes will empower your decisions.

Making Your Remodel a Success: Key Tips

  • Communicate, Communicate, Communicate: Maintain open and frequent dialogue with your contractor and design team.
  • Be Prepared for Disruption: Remodeling is messy and noisy. Plan for dust, temporary inconveniences, and potential changes to your daily routine.
  • Have a Clear Contract: Ensure all details – scope of work, materials, timeline, payment schedule, and contingency plans – are clearly outlined in a written agreement.
  • Don’t Compromise on Quality: While budgeting is important, cutting corners on essential elements like plumbing, electrical work, or structural integrity can lead to costly problems down the road.
  • Trust the Process: Remodeling can have its ups and downs. Trust your chosen professionals and try to enjoy the evolution of your home.
